What Do Flowers Symbolize?

Flowers are most commonly known to symbolize joy and pleasure due to their beautiful scent and flourishing nature. But there’s more to it. In addition to being a symbol of friendship and purity, flowers may also represent grief, death, and forgiveness.

Therefore, dreaming of them can mean different things depending on the type of flower and the way it’s presented in a dream.

The Spirituality Hidden Within Flower Dreams

Many religions convey messages through the symbolism of flowers. In the Biblical sense, flowers are a symbol of joy, peace, and hope. It may be a sign you’re about to experience a spiritual awakening—the soul blooms like a flower. The red rose, for example, symbolizes the Virgin Mary and means love and passion. 

In the Quran, flowers are connected to the essential process of conception. Also, the Islamic artwork is embellished with flowers to enhance the feeling of peace.

Regarding Hinduism, you’ll see that flowers are an integral part of the religion. Hindu rites and customs are enriched with flowers to gain good health, wealth, and prosperity. The lotus flower, being of great significance, brings purity and wisdom. 

Buddhism doesn’t differ, associating the flower’s growth stage with the path of enlightenment. For Buddhists, the lotus symbolizes the highest level of spiritual elevation. 

Hence, your religious beliefs do have the power to shape your dreams, send spiritual messages, and potentially bring comfort when needed.
